public class BatchRemovalByFormInstanceIdListRequest
extends com.aliyun.tea.TeaModel
限定符和类型 | 字段和说明 |
---|---|
String |
appType
宜搭应用编码
|
Boolean |
asynchronousExecution
是否需要宜搭服务端异步执行该任务(选择异步执行删除操作,那么OpenAPI调用会立即返回,并且宜搭服务端会继续执行删除操作直至结束,且允许的单次删除数据量上限更大)
|
Boolean |
executeExpression
是否需要触发表单绑定的校验规则、关联业务规则和第三方服务回调(如果您的业务无必要执行这些,那么请填false以降低API的耗时以及获得更大的单次删除数据量上限)
|
List<String> |
formInstanceIdList
表单实例id列表
|
String |
formUuid
表单编码
|
String |
systemToken
宜搭应用秘钥
|
String |
userId
钉钉userId
|
构造器和说明 |
---|
BatchRemovalByFormInstanceIdListRequest() |
限定符和类型 | 方法和说明 |
---|---|
static BatchRemovalByFormInstanceIdListRequest |
build(Map<String,?> map) |
String |
getAppType() |
Boolean |
getAsynchronousExecution() |
Boolean |
getExecuteExpression() |
List<String> |
getFormInstanceIdList() |
String |
getFormUuid() |
String |
getSystemToken() |
String |
getUserId() |
BatchRemovalByFormInstanceIdListRequest |
setAppType(String appType) |
BatchRemovalByFormInstanceIdListRequest |
setAsynchronousExecution(Boolean asynchronousExecution) |
BatchRemovalByFormInstanceIdListRequest |
setExecuteExpression(Boolean executeExpression) |
BatchRemovalByFormInstanceIdListRequest |
setFormInstanceIdList(List<String> formInstanceIdList) |
BatchRemovalByFormInstanceIdListRequest |
setFormUuid(String formUuid) |
BatchRemovalByFormInstanceIdListRequest |
setSystemToken(String systemToken) |
BatchRemovalByFormInstanceIdListRequest |
setUserId(String userId) |
@NameInMap(value="appType") public String appType
宜搭应用编码
@NameInMap(value="asynchronousExecution") public Boolean asynchronousExecution
是否需要宜搭服务端异步执行该任务(选择异步执行删除操作,那么OpenAPI调用会立即返回,并且宜搭服务端会继续执行删除操作直至结束,且允许的单次删除数据量上限更大)
@NameInMap(value="executeExpression") public Boolean executeExpression
是否需要触发表单绑定的校验规则、关联业务规则和第三方服务回调(如果您的业务无必要执行这些,那么请填false以降低API的耗时以及获得更大的单次删除数据量上限)
@NameInMap(value="formInstanceIdList") public List<String> formInstanceIdList
表单实例id列表
@NameInMap(value="formUuid") public String formUuid
表单编码
@NameInMap(value="systemToken") public String systemToken
宜搭应用秘钥
@NameInMap(value="userId") public String userId
钉钉userId
public static BatchRemovalByFormInstanceIdListRequest build(Map<String,?> map) throws Exception
Exception
public BatchRemovalByFormInstanceIdListRequest setAppType(String appType)
public String getAppType()
public BatchRemovalByFormInstanceIdListRequest setAsynchronousExecution(Boolean asynchronousExecution)
public Boolean getAsynchronousExecution()
public BatchRemovalByFormInstanceIdListRequest setExecuteExpression(Boolean executeExpression)
public Boolean getExecuteExpression()
public BatchRemovalByFormInstanceIdListRequest setFormInstanceIdList(List<String> formInstanceIdList)
public BatchRemovalByFormInstanceIdListRequest setFormUuid(String formUuid)
public String getFormUuid()
public BatchRemovalByFormInstanceIdListRequest setSystemToken(String systemToken)
public String getSystemToken()
public BatchRemovalByFormInstanceIdListRequest setUserId(String userId)
public String getUserId()
Copyright © 2023. All rights reserved.